The Rematch That Defines Eras

Artur Beterbiev and Dmitry Bivol will lock horns once more, this time with the undisputed light heavyweight championship on the line. Their first encounter was a thrilling display of skill and strategy, leaving fans craving more. Beterbiev’s power and precision have earned him a reputation as a formidable force, while Bivol’s tactical brilliance has made him a fan favorite. This rematch not only promises to settle scores but also solidify one of these warriors as a true legend of the sport.Their paths to this moment have been marked by relentless dedication and remarkable achievements. Both fighters bring unique styles into the ring—Beterbiev’s explosive power versus Bivol’s calculated finesse. The stakes couldn't be higher, with both men eager to prove their dominance. As they step into the ring, all eyes will be on them, waiting to witness history unfold.

A Heavyweight Clash for the Ages

In the co-main event, Daniel Dubois faces off against Joseph Parker for the IBF world heavyweight title. Dubois, fresh from his stunning victory over Anthony Joshua, enters the fray with renewed confidence and momentum. His aggressive style and youthful exuberance make him a formidable opponent, while Parker brings experience and tactical acumen to the table. This bout represents a clash of generations, pitting raw talent against seasoned expertise. Dubois’ ability to impose his will early in the fight could give him an edge, but Parker’s resilience and strategic mindset may lead him to outlast his younger counterpart. The heavyweight division has long been a stage for epic battles, and this encounter promises to live up to that legacy. Fans can expect a grueling contest that tests the limits of both fighters.

Rising Stars and Unstoppable Forces

Beyond the main events, the undercard features several rising stars ready to make their mark. Shakur Stevenson, known for his exceptional skill and poise, takes on Josh Padley in a match that feels straight out of a Hollywood script. Stevenson’s journey from amateur standout to professional champion has been nothing short of inspiring. Facing Padley, a part-time electrician turned boxer, adds an intriguing narrative layer to the fight.Meanwhile, Hamzah Sheeraz aims to capture the WBC middleweight title in what could be a defining moment for his career. Sheeraz, often referred to as the golden boy of Riyadh, combines charisma and skill inside the ring. His opponent, Carlos Adames, presents a significant challenge, but Sheeraz’s determination and versatility make him a strong contender. This matchup offers a glimpse into the future of the middleweight division, where new champions are born.

Legends Past and Present

Reflecting on boxing’s storied past, it’s hard not to draw parallels between this event and some of the sport’s most iconic nights. The 1990s saw legendary figures like Naseem Hamed and Mike Tyson dominate headlines with their electrifying performances. Hamed’s conquest of New York in 1997, where he knocked out Kevin Kelley in spectacular fashion, remains a memorable highlight. Similarly, Tyson’s shocking defeat to Evander Holyfield in 1996 marked a turning point in boxing history.These moments underscore the unpredictable nature of the sport, where any given night can produce unexpected outcomes.
